New addition to the RAF/RN section - the Hawker Hunter ! Out of the blue, AlphaSim brings you a state of the art Hawker Hunter FS model set - no effort was spared to create the finest package of its kind. Featuring the single-seater variants F.6, F.6A. FGA.9 and Mk.58A in no less than eight texture sets, including the famous Swiss display scheme and both Black Arrows and Blue Diamonds RAF display liveries. This product has it all, including full FSX (Acceleration Pack) compatibility with bump-mapping, self shadowing (in the v-c too with SP2) and bloom effects, a custom Hunter Avon sounds package, high-detail v-c and custom animations for the pilot figure, speedbrake and even the intake / engine covers and pitot warning tags can be displayed. Carefully-researched flight dynamics provide a very accurate Hunter sim experience, an illustrated panel guide in 'Pilot's Notes' style provides all the cockpit information. The external model recreates the classic Hunter shape perfectly, the textures are highly accurate and even feature custom alpha maps for optimum reflectivity in both sims, the source textures are provided for repainters to use (.psd's). Pilot auto-movements and a correctly-animated ventral speedbrake (wheels-up use only), coupled with wingtip vortex, startup / exhaust smoke and turbine glow, all make for a highly authentic and enjoyable Hawker Hunter simulation. For FSX and FS2004 only.
Filesize - FSX : 87MB, FS9 : 101MB.
Price :approx. $46 USD, £23.50, 31.50 EUR, 52.50 AUD.
